A working group within the Intergovernmental Panel on Climate Change had recently released its Climate Change 2022: Mitigation of Climate Change report as part of the IPCC Sixth Assessment Report, stating that action to reduce the most extreme effects of climate change would need to happen "now or never" and leading Antnio Guterres to criticize "a litany of broken climate promises" by world leaders. Climate-related natural disasters and other crises were also increasing at the time;[10] Bruce's home of Colorado had experienced its most destructive wildfire ever in December 2021,[2] and its three largest wildfires ever in 2020. [13] Kanko and other leaders of the Rocky Mountain Ecodharma Retreat Center subsequently released a statement asserting that no Buddhist teacher in Boulder had preexisting knowledge of Bruce's plans, and stating that while they had never "talked about self-immolation" and "do not think self-immolation is a climate action", they understood why someone might resort to self-immolation "given the dire state of the planet and worsening climate crisis".
